AI in Sales: The Good, the Bad, and the Ugly

In this episode of 'AI in Sales: The Good, The Bad, and The Ugly,' Jack Naish is joined by Mike Pritchett to dive into the transformative impact of artificial intelligence on modern sales organizations. They explore how AI-powered tools are reshaping sales workflows by automating repetitive tasks, prioritizing leads, and personalizing outreach—freeing up reps to focus on high-value selling activities. The discussion highlights industry data showing that while only a third of a sales rep’s time is spent actively selling, AI adoption is driving measurable revenue increases and helping teams overcome common challenges like content discovery and training retention.

The conversation doesn’t shy away from the complexities and potential pitfalls of AI in sales. The hosts examine both the advantages—such as improved coaching, real-time performance feedback, and smarter content management—and the drawbacks, including over-reliance on automation and the risk of losing the human touch. This is a nuanced conversation on how to leverage AI for smarter selling, what to watch out for as adoption accelerates, and actionable insights for integrating AI-driven solutions to boost sales effectiveness and team productivity.
